Yorktown is set to launch its annual Sounds of Summer Concert Series on May 22, 2025. This popular event will occur every Thursday evening from 6:30 PM to 9 PM at Riverwalk Landing, culminating in a final performance on August 14, 2025. Notably, there will be no concert on July 3, allowing attendees to celebrate the Independence Day weekend without interruption.
The concert series will kick off with an opening act by BrassWind, marking the 20th Anniversary of Riverwalk Landing. A diverse lineup of performances is scheduled, featuring music across various genres such as rock-n-roll, R&B, pop, beach, and country. Residents and visitors alike are encouraged to come early to enjoy dinner or dessert from the waterfront restaurants that characterize Historic Yorktown.
The events are designed to be family-friendly and community-oriented, bringing residents together for evenings of entertainment. Attendees will find various amenities at the Riverwalk Landing, including a dance floor, corn hole games, and a selection of food trucks offering a range of culinary choices.
For those planning to attend, it is important to note that while guests are welcome to bring their own blankets, chairs, and small coolers, larger items such as tables, umbrellas, or tents are not permitted to ensure a comfortable environment for all concertgoers. Additionally, individuals may bring their own alcohol, which must be consumed within the designated ABC area.
Parking is made convenient for visitors with free facilities at several locations including the Riverwalk Landing Parking Terrace, York Hall, York-Poquoson Courthouse, and the County Administration Building, along with other designated public parking lots. Complementing these arrangements is the Yorktown Trolley, which offers free and wheelchair-accessible transportation running until 9:30 PM for every concert. This trolley will follow a modified route with stops on the outskirts of town, further simplifying access to the event.
As with any outdoor events, updates regarding inclement weather will be readily available. Attendees can check the status of concerts through the official York County Event Weather Hotline at 757-890-3520, along with posts on Facebook and Instagram.
